      Where does committer come from?

      The word committer breaks down into 3 roots of Latin origin: com-, from Latin com (“together, with”); mitt, from Latin mittere (“to send”); and -er, from Latin -arius (“agent, one who does”). Explore each root to see other English words built from the same source.
